IEC TC 105: Fuel Cell Technologies Update
by Karen Hall
Vice President, Technical Operations of the
National Hydrogen Association
The 5th Plenary meeting of International Electrotechnical
Commission Technical Committee 105 (IEC TC 105) was held in
Tokyo, Japan, on June 24th and 25th 2004.
The following is a summary of Working Group (WG) activity:
WG 1 Terminology
Approved, in publication process.
Project: IEC 62282-1 TR Ed. 1.0
WG 1 held a meeting prior to the plenary meeting on Wednesday
(23 June) to discuss the comments received. The result of
voting on 105/64/DTS including the comments will be circulated
in July. As soon as the clean English version of the paper
is available, it will be forwarded to the secretary who will
ask the French national committee for a translation. Both
the English and the French version will go to the IEC Central
Office for publication. After publication, the status of WG
1 will change to: maintenance committee. A permanent
update of this Technical Report is possible. Via the IEC fast
track procedure, publication is ensured within a maximum period
of 24 months.

WG 3 Stationary fuel cell power plants safety
Draft completed, out for public comment by national committees
Project: IEC 62282-3-1 Ed. 1.0
The project IEC 62282-3-1 Ed. 1.0 has been cancelled by the
IEC SMB, because a Committee Draft (CD) could not be submitted
within 3 years after the initiation of the project. The main
reason for the delay has been the complexity of the task.
Further proceedings: Project leader, Mr. Kelvin Hecht, will
submit a draft to the secretary within July 2004. This draft
will be attached to a New Work Item Proposal (NWIP) as a CD.

WG5 Stationary Fuel Cell Power Plants - Installation
Reorganized, new chairman, NFPA 853 approved as seed document,
to meet in Munich 10/25-27.
Project: IEC 62282-3-3 Ed. 1.0
Very little progress has been made in the working group so
far. The represented countries have agreed that this situation
is unsatisfactory and have decided to change the project leader.
By unanimous decision Mr. Gerhard Huppmann has been appointed
as the new project leader replacing Mr. Andrew Skok. The secretary
will request in his report to the SMB that in the program
of work the target date of the 1st CD will be changed to June
2007.
Proposal by The Netherlands: ISO/TC197 wants to establish
a working group dealing with installation requirements for
fuel processors. A joint working group (JWG) between TC105
and ISO/TC197 dealing with installation requirements should
be taken into consideration.
Decision: The Netherlands will propose in next weeks
ISO/TC197 plenary meeting to set up a JWG. If ISO/TC197 agrees
upon the proposal by TC105, the creation of an IEC/ISO Joint
Working Group will be brought to the attention of the management
boards of IEC and ISO. The two committees will have to agree
on the organization that takes leadership of the joint project.

WG 7 Portable fuel cell appliances - Safety and performance
requirements
Draft in progress.
Project: IEC 62282-5 Ed. 1.0
WG 7 held a meeting prior to the plenary meeting on Tuesday
and Wednesday (22-23 June) to discuss the comments received,
and modify the CD as considered to be appropriate. The comments
received on the CD, along with the observations of the secretariat,
will be sent to the IEC Central Office for circulation to
the national committees as a CC in July 2004. By November,
the revised document will be sent to the IEC Central Office
for circulation to the national committees as a CDV.
